Labor Day travel concludes with brief TSA lines at Atlanta airport.

Labor Day Travel Insights

Labor Day weekend has concluded, with millions returning home, and travelers at Atlanta’s Hartsfield-Jackson Airport reported smooth experiences on Tuesday morning.

Travel Projections

From September 2 to September 9, around 2.3 million passengers are expected to pass through the airport, reflecting a 1% increase compared to last year’s travel figures.

Passenger Feedback

Despite the anticipated increase in crowd sizes, many passengers noted that lines were moving swiftly. Melvin Webb, heading to Baltimore, expressed his surprise, stating, “This is kind of scary, to tell you the truth. Even last week, it was more than this.” He suggested that perhaps more travelers are extending their trips before returning to work.

Flight Data

The FAA has forecasted over 280,000 flights nationwide during the travel period, including more than 47,000 flights scheduled for Tuesday alone.

Conclusion

Overall, the travel experience at Atlanta’s airport during this busy period appears to be efficient, with many passengers finding their journeys manageable.
